Westmoor is on a three-game streak of home losses, Carlmont a three-game streak of away losses, but someone's luck will change on Monday. The Westmoor Rams will host the Carlmont Scots at 6:00 p.m. Given that the two teams suffered a loss in their last games, they both have a little extra motivation heading into this contest.
Westmoor lost 51-29 to Summit Shasta on Saturday.
Meanwhile, Carlmont ended up a good deal behind Hillsdale on Friday and lost 58-39. While losing is never fun, the Scots can't take it too hard given the team's big disadvantage in MaxPreps' California basketball rankings (they are ranked 406th, while the FIGHTING KNIGHTS are ranked 122nd).
Carlmont's defeat dropped their record down to 8-10. As for Westmoor, their loss dropped their record down to 7-7.
